Transaction 59a07eabda5d53b3d09f9a5db81621e0e8af16c333f2b2d466ba23ebd6d88f91

100 Input
1 Outputs
  • 59a07eabda5d53b3d09f9a5db81621e0e8af16c333f2b2d466ba23ebd6d88f91:0
  • value  197962859
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h